RETREATING<br />

into a shell<br />

Do you have a family member who<br />

is starting to shy away from family<br />

gatherings? Are they saying “Nah”,<br />

more often than “Yeah”, when a social<br />

function is suggested? They may not<br />

want to admit it, but they may have<br />

developed a problem with their hearing.<br />

Retreating into your shell is a common<br />

coping mechanism for those with<br />

hearing difficulties.<br />

The most common type of hearing loss<br />

is due to gradual damage to minute<br />

nerve endings in the inner ear. This<br />

causes a reduction of speech clarity,<br />

with the beginning and endings of<br />

words or sentences dropping away.<br />

This is incredibly frustrating, as it can<br />

sound like people are not speaking<br />

clearly. The biggest problem, however,<br />

is that background noise can be heard<br />

just as loud as always, meaning that<br />

understanding conversation in a group<br />

or social situation can be very difficult.<br />

As a rule, most people do not like to<br />

admit to having hearing difficulties, so<br />

when in a situation where conversation<br />

is becoming hard to follow, most people<br />

will try to bluff their way through, nod<br />

and smile and hope they get away with<br />

it. Trying to make out what is being<br />

said in such a situation is very mentally<br />

tiring, so you can understand why a<br />

future invitation to such an event may be<br />

turned down.<br />
